(b). International support:
The United Nations Industrial Development Organization (UNIDO), along with other agencies and industry associations, undertook a pilot programme involving 20 auto component manufacturers in Maharashtra, to impart shop-floor level technical assistance from experts. This included training and application of the principles of lean production. The programme cost $ 305,000. The following table shows the measures adopted and resulting benefits accrued to the component manufacturers: -

Measures Adopted Benefits Accrued
Workspace relayout and changes in production flow 40% reduction in product throughput time
SMED (Single-Minute Exchange of Die) in plastic and metal die sub-sectors 75% reduction in die changeover time
25% reduction in delivery lead time of a variety of products
Introducing standard operating procedures 75% reduction in production lead time
Preventive maintenance practices 30% reduction in machine downtime

Table 1: UNIDO Industrial Partnership Programme - Measures and Benefits
(Source: Adapted from Timmins 2005)
